The Internet of Things (IoT) refers to networks of physical devices, including sensors, actuators, embedded controllers, and everyday objects, that collect and exchange data over the internet without requiring direct human operation. An IoT system typically combines a sensing layer, a communication layer using protocols such as MQTT, Zigbee, and 5G, and an application layer that processes data at the edge or in the cloud. Core research problems include energy-efficient sensor design, low-latency edge computing, interoperability across heterogeneous devices, and securing large numbers of resource-constrained endpoints against intrusion. Industry estimates suggest most enterprise-generated data will soon be processed at the network edge rather than centralized data centers, reinforcing edge computing as an active research area. IoT underpins smart homes, industrial automation, precision agriculture, connected healthcare devices, and smart city infrastructure.
